The "whale that bought WBTC and ETH at high prices using revolving loans" continued to sell 400 WBTC at a loss to repay the loan.

PANews reported on January 26 that, according to on-chain analyst Yu Jin, a "whale that bought $263 million worth of WBTC and ETH at high prices through a revolving loan" continued to sell 400 WBTC at a loss today after BTC fell to $86,000, exchanging them for 34.67 million USDT to repay the loan. The selling price was $86,694.

He has already suffered a huge loss of $51.17 million due to buying high and selling low.

  • The 18,517 ETH (worth $81.75 million) bought at $4,415 have all been sold off at an average price of $3,049, resulting in a loss of $25.29 million.
  • The 1,560 WBTC (worth $182 million) bought at $116,762 have been sold at an average price of $89,798, resulting in a loss of $25.88 million.
